3. Don't Over-Pressure


Pressure washing is a reliable means to eliminate stains and dust, mold, mildew, algae, and moss from outdoor surface areas like siding, driveways, decks, home windows, and also automobiles. However, it's important to not over-pressure a surface because highly pressurized water can harm paint or soft products such as wood outdoor decking.

When making use of a stress washer, start by spraying 3-4 feet away from the object you're trying to clean. This permits you to evaluate the amount of water pressure that is required. When you have an idea of how much stress to apply, slowly move the stick closer and test again. This makes sure that the surface you're cleansing isn't damaged by an extremely extreme application of water stress. 5. Use the Right Cleaning Agent


Pressure washing is an efficient method to clean surface areas, eliminating dust, mold, mildew, debris, and even some kinds of paint. It likewise helps to avoid disease-causing germs and vermin from breeding on surface areas that are infested with their spores.

Making use of the appropriate detergent with your pressure washer makes a huge distinction in how well the cleansing procedure functions. For example, soap breaks down grease and oil on the surface so it can be removed a lot more quickly with water. Soap additionally helps to soften dirt and crud for faster and extra effective cleansing.
